Phoenix — Luka Doncic Leaving the Mavericks Thursday night win over Phoenix Suns After a left ankle sprain.

He never returned to play or to the Dallas bench.

Coach Jason Kidd said Doncic was “feeling fine” after the win, but didn’t provide details about the 23-year-old’s All-Star status ahead of Saturday’s game against the Jazz.

“He looked good. He looked fine,” Kidd said. We’ll probably have more information once we get to Utah. ”

Kidd said he spoke with Doncic before halftime and the post-match press conference.

“He was laughing,” Kidd said. His grit for his DP tonight was at a high level. The hallmark of that team is that they played hard and found ways to win. ”

Less than four minutes into the game, the 23-year-old superstar began limping after pivoting in the post and stepping on the foot of a Suns defender. Doncic did not fall to the floor, but he quickly defended by grabbing his left ankle and dragging his leg. When the Mavericks got the ball back, Jason Kidd his coach called a timeout.

Casey Smith, director of player health and performance, met Doncic on the court when play stopped and walked directly into the locker room with him.

Doncic has not missed a game through injury this season, missing just five of the Mavericks’ first 50 games.
